Popularity and Distribution

The surname Guisinger is quite rare, with only a few hundred individuals bearing this name worldwide. In the United States, where the surname is most prevalent, there are approximately 913 individuals with the surname Guisinger. This indicates that the surname is relatively uncommon, even in the US. In Argentina and Guatemala, the surname Guisinger is even rarer, with only 1 individual bearing this name in each country. This suggests that the surname has not spread widely outside of the United States, further indicating its rarity and uniqueness.
